
I went to make a comment on a YouTube video today and was welcomed with the above pop-up from YouTube basically telling me to "Start using your full name on YouTube" with an example of what my current YouTube account appears like ("jimyounkin") and how it will appear ("Jim Younkin III"). It appears in the image above that YouTube (owned by Google) is pulling your "real name" from your Google+ account.
Now, for me, I already use my "full name" on my YouTube channel but judging from almost every other YouTube channel name I've ever seen I am severly in the minority. Most people don't have their "real name" on their YouTube channel.

Privacy? What Privacy!
I find this change especially tone-deaf mainly for the fact that the majority of users are likely to not want to make this drastic a change. Going from something like "skipro865" to "George Jones" sure does remove some of the "distance" that online pseudonyms afford.

Haters Gonna Hate
Of course that may be YouTube (and Google's) whole point for making this change. "skipro865" calling you an "ugly douchebag" doesn't quite have the same feeling as having "George Jones" call you an "ugly douchebag".
While removing anonymity may make some YouTube commentors (often held up as one of the most trustworthy examples of the Internet Fuckwad Theory at work) think twice about sprewing bilious nonsense all over YouTube videos, if previous attempts to "unmask" users for the sake of curbing "bad behavior" are any indication, YouTube/Google may be have an uphill battle on their hands.
